Riverside moms honor our heroes

RIVERSIDE, Calif. The event is to take place on Sunday, Sept. 7 from 3 p.m. to 8 p.m. at Fairmount Park's band shell.

The park is located at 2601 Park Blvd in Riverside.

Everyone is invited and the event is free.

"Fuelled by the Fallen," a memorial race car team that features '60s-era Chevy Novas with the names of fallen Marines painted on them, will also be on display. The autos are a project of actor Kevyn Major Howard from the film "Full Metal Jacket." He will also attend.

The event also features live music, as well as clowns and face painting for the children.

A 21-gun salute, Taps and a candlelight vigil take place at twilight.

"This event is to remember our fallen heroes of 9/11, local fallen heroes, police officers, firefighters, veterans and to support our troops," said Mary Badalamente of the chapter. She is a mother-in-law of a Marine major now in Iraq. "We are not about politics; we are about being Americans."
